What are PIP incapacity funds and the way are they altering?

Liz Kendall has as we speak introduced modifications to the incapacity assist system PIP (Private Independence Fee).

Regardless of rumours that the federal government would scrap the profit altogether, the work and pensions secretary has mentioned PIP is right here to remain, however will probably be tougher to qualify for.

Ms Kendall mentioned the reforms will save £5bn a yr by the tip of the last decade.

However what’s PIP, who is ready to get it, what’s the authorities planning to vary and who can be impacted?

This is what it is advisable know.

What’s PIP?

PIP is a tax-free cost given to individuals to assist with the additional prices brought on by long-term ill-health or incapacity.

There are two components to it:

A each day residing half – for many who have a long-term bodily or psychological well being situation or disabilityA mobility half – for individuals who have problem doing sure on a regular basis duties or getting round.

It is potential to fulfill the factors for one half or each components, and funds fluctuate for every.

Those that qualify for the each day residing half are given both a decrease price of £72.65 per week or a better price of £108.55, and people who qualify for the mobility half both obtain £28.70 or £75.75.

What’s modified?

Basically, somewhat than freezing PIP, Ms Kendall introduced a change to the evaluation for the profit, which is geared toward serving to the disabled with the elevated price of residing related to their circumstances.

Folks will now want to attain at the very least 4 factors in a single exercise to qualify.

The difference would require a change in legislation, which Ms Kendall mentioned the federal government plans to do.

Reacting to the proposed change, the Incapacity Advantages Consortium, an umbrella physique representing greater than 100 charities and organisations, mentioned the cuts had been “cruel”.

The consortium’s coverage co-chairman Charles Gillies mentioned: “These immoral and devastating benefits cuts will push more disabled people into poverty, and worsen people’s health.”

How does the federal government make its choices?

The Division for Work and Pensions (DWP) carries out an evaluation to work out the extent of assist an individual ought to obtain.

An individual’s wants are judged on a factors system whereby the extra extreme the impression in a specific space and the larger the assistance that’s required, the extra factors an individual will get and the extra money they obtain.

For instance, an applicant will get two factors on the each day residing rating if they should use an assist or equipment (like a prostheses or straightforward grip handles on utensils) when cooking a meal, or they’ll get eight factors if they can’t put together meals or cook dinner in any respect.

Equally for the mobility rating, the applicant will get 4 factors if they’ll stand and transfer between 50 metres and 200 metres, and 12 factors if they’ll solely transfer between one metre and 20 metres.

The solutions are assessed by well being professionals who then present a report for DWP case managers with suggestions on what to offer the applicant, if something.

Candidates can present assessors with further medical proof as a part of a declare, however it isn’t a requirement, as an individual’s self-assessment concerning the impression their situation is prioritised when making a choice.

Who’s at the moment eligible?

Folks aged between 16-64 can get PIP no matter whether or not they work in the event that they anticipate their difficulties to final for at the very least 12 months from after they began.

Those that have been advised they could have 12 months or much less to stay may also apply and should get PIP extra shortly.

Victims of each bodily incapacity and cognitive or psychological well being circumstances like anxiousness can meet the factors for each forms of PIP.

There is no such thing as a record of medical circumstances that decide who qualifies for PIP. As an alternative, candidates are assessed on the extent of assist they want with particular actions.

For the each day residing half, individuals may need assistance with issues like:

Getting ready foodEating and drinkingManaging medicines or treatmentsWashing and bathingUsing the toiletDressing and undressingReadingSocialising and being round different peopleTalking, listening and understanding.

For the mobility funds, there’s help for issues like:

Understanding a route and following itPhysically shifting aroundLeaving your own home.
